Clean Windows 11 Installation & Activation
1Boot from Installation Media
Insert your Windows 11 USB/DVD and boot from it. You may need to change boot order in BIOS/UEFI settings.
2Begin Installation Process
Select your language, time format, and keyboard method, then click "Next" and "Install now".
3Enter Product Key
When prompted, enter your 25-character Windows 11 product key (format: XXXXX-XXXXX-XXXXX-XXXXX-XXXXX). If you don't have it ready, click "I don't have a product key" to enter it later.
4Select Windows Edition
Choose the correct Windows 11 edition that matches your product key (Home, Pro, Education, etc.).
5Complete Installation
Accept license terms, choose installation type (Custom for clean install), select drive, and let Windows install.
6Activate After Setup
If you skipped entering the key during installation, go to Settings > System > Activation and click "Change product key" to enter it now.
Activate Existing Windows 11 Installation
1Open Settings
Press Windows key + I, or right-click the Start button and select "Settings".
2Navigate to Activation
Click on "System" in the left sidebar, then scroll down and click on "Activation".
3Change Product Key
Click on "Change product key" next to the activation status.
4Enter Your Key
Type your 25-character Windows 11 product key in the format: XXXXX-XXXXX-XXXXX-XXXXX-XXXXX
5Activate Windows
Click "Next" and then "Activate". Windows will verify your key and activate automatically if valid.

Upgrade Windows 11 Home to Pro
1Verify Current Edition
Press Windows key + R, type "winver" and press Enter to confirm you have Windows 11 Home.
2Open Settings
Press Windows key + I to open Settings, then navigate to System > Activation.
3Upgrade Your Edition
Look for "Upgrade your edition of Windows" and click on "Go to Store" or "Change product key".
4Enter Pro Product Key
Enter your Windows 11 Pro product key. This will automatically start the upgrade process.

5Wait for Upgrade
Windows will download and install Pro features. This may take 10-30 minutes and require a restart.
6Verify Upgrade
After restart, check Settings > System > About to confirm you now have Windows 11 Pro activated.
